Ukraine 18-Year-Old Who Nearly Faced Russian Conscription Returns... Over 300 Returnees from 'Forced Relocation'

Mrs. Zelenska Posts on Telegram

On the 9th (local time), Olena Zelenska, wife of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ky, revealed that hundreds of Ukrainian children who were forcibly relocated to Russia during the war have returned to their homeland.


On the same day, Zelenska posted on her Telegram channel, stating, "Out of approximately 20,000 children kidnapped to Russia, we have succeeded in repatriating 387."

Zelenska attended a child return event held at the Ukrainian Child Rights Protection Center, where she met and encouraged the freed children.


In the case of Bohdan Yermokin (18), he was taken to Russia along with other children from the orphanage where he was staying when he was 17. While living in a boarding school in Russia, after his birthday passed and he turned a year older, he was about to receive a military conscription notice from the Russian authorities. He was at risk of being deployed to the front lines and forced to point a gun at his compatriots, but with the help of those around him, he safely escaped and was able to return home.


Zelenska explained that Ukraine did not have direct contact with Russia during the rescue process, and that the operation was made possible thanks to international cooperation involving third-country officials. She pointed out that a significant number of the kidnapped children are orphans or in situations where they cannot receive parental support.


She said, "We are placing great hope in a child rescue operation proposed by Canada a month ago, which will soon be implemented," adding, "We must ensure that all children can return."
